While no federal law bans sleeping in your car (unless youre intoxicated), each state and city has its own rules known as vehicle habitation laws. Whether youre taking a quick nap on a trip or living in your vehicle, you need to look up the local ordinances that govern whether and where you can sleep in your car. You can legally sleep in your car on the Bureau of Land Management (BLM) public land. Staying on this land is scenic, budget-friendly (often free), and legal. However, there are local ordinances in some cities that make sleeping in a car a crime. Some states allow you to park for a few hours during the day to catch a few zzzs (California, for instance, allows parking for 8 hours, just not overnight), so be sure to stay updated on the laws of your state.
